Safety Considerations for Tiny Toys
Ensuring Safety in Miniature Toy Choices
Safety considerations are paramount when diving into the universe of tiny toys. As these items become smaller and more intricate, potential hazards also rise, especially for young children. To ensure these globes of joy are both exciting and secure, it's crucial to be aware of a few key aspects.
Tiny components and intricate designs can sometimes pose a choking risk. Brands that are committed to safety often provide clear age guidelines, highlighting the appropriate age group for their toys. For instance, the smallest hot wheels or the world's smallest kits typically carry age warnings due to their diminutive parts. Always ensure these toys are used under supervision, especially if they're brought into the world of younger siblings.
Moreover, when considering something from a wheels series or even a smallest barbie set, check for safety certifications. Toys sold at a regular price or sale price should still adhere to rigorous safety standards. Certifications not only assure quality but also verify that the toys have passed stringent checks.
